Abstract :
The dissociative excitation of BrCN producing CN(B2Σ+) fragment by the collision of He*(23S) was investigated by the collision energy-resolved electron and emission spectroscopy using time-of-flight method with a high-intensity He* beam. The Penning electrons ejected from BrCN and the subsequent CN(B2Σ+–X2Σ+) emission were measured as a function of collision energy in the range of 90–180 meV. The formation of CN(B2Σ+) is concluded to proceed dominantly via the promotion of an electron from Π-character orbital, by comparison between the collision energy dependence of the partial Penning ionization cross-sections and the CN(B2Σ+–X2Σ+) emission cross-section.
